I noticed in package manager that I have installed SUNWndmp version 
0.5.11-0.86, packaged on April 26, 2008.  If I load 
http://pkg.opensolaris.org/status in my webbrowser, I noticed multiple later 
versions of this package.  Package manager claims otherwise, that the April 
26th version is the latest.  When attempting to install the latest FMRI 
SUNWndmp package using:

pfexec pkg install pkg:/[EMAIL PROTECTED],5.11-0.101:20081104T023852Z

It complains that this package conflicts with constraint in installed 
pkg:/entire:
Pkg SUNWndmp: Optional min_version: 0.5.11,5.11-0.86 max version: 
0.5.11,0.5-11-0.86 defined by pkg:entire.

If I issue a pkg contents -r, the contents of the November 4th package appears, 
so the newer package does exist.  Is this a limitation of OpenSolaris (I 
installed off a Live CD) or is there something screwy going on with the 
pkg.opensolaris.org repository?
